For example: All templates that submit forms via POST All have had their <form action="x.php" method="post"> replaced with <form action="x.php?do=$do&itemid=$itemid" method="post"> to allow better webserver logging of POST requests. Requires revert? No, none of these changes are required, they simply improve the verbosity of web server log entries. |
